The Swedish Pharmacy Landscape: Apotek
Before checking out particular medications, it is essential to comprehend where and how pharmaceutical products are dispersed in Sweden.
Unlike some nations where a wide range of painkillers can be acquired in corner store or supermarkets, Sweden strictly manages the sale of pharmaceuticals. Until 2009, the state-owned monopoly Apoteket AB was the sole service provider of medicines. Today, while the marketplace has been deregulated to allow personal operators, all pharmacies-- collectively referred to as apotek-- run under strict guidance by the Swedish Medical Products Agency (Läkemedelsverket).
Non-prescription (OTC) vs. Prescription Medications
In Sweden, pain reducers are divided into two primary categories:
Handelsvaror (Non-pharmacy goods): Very mild analgesics, such as particular low-dose solutions, may sometimes be found outside standard pharmacies, however the huge majority of pain relief items should be bought at a licensed apotek.
Receptfria läkemedel (OTC medications): Pain relievers like paracetamol and certain NSAIDs can be purchased off the rack or requested at the drug store counter without a doctor's prescription, though age limitations and purchase amounts frequently use.
Receptbelagda läkemedel (Prescription medications): Stronger analgesics, consisting of opioids and particular nerve-pain medications, need a legitimate prescription from a certified Swedish healthcare supplier.
Typical Pain Medications Available in Sweden
When seeking relief for headaches, muscular pains, or post-surgical discomfort, understanding the local names and classifications of basic medications is helpful.
Generic Name Typical Brand Names in Sweden Common Usage Availability
Paracetamol Alvedon, Panodil, Pamol Moderate to moderate pain, fever reduction OTC (Age restrictions apply)
Ibuprofen Ibumetin, Ipren, Iprenox Swelling, muscular pain, headaches OTC (Age constraints use)
Naproxen Pronaxen, Naprosyn Longer-lasting inflammatory pain, joint pain OTC/ Prescription (depending upon dose)
Acetylsalicylic Acid Aspirin, Bamyl Moderate pain, fever, blood thinning OTC
Tramadol Tradolan, Tramadol Moderate to serious pain Prescription Only
Oxycodone/ Morphine OxyNorm, Oxynorm, Ketogan Severe intense or persistent pain Stringent Prescription Only
Keep in mind: Brand names in Sweden might differ, however the active pharmaceutical ingredient (in Swedish: "verksam substans") is always clearly listed on the packaging.
Getting OTC Pain Relievers
For everyday aches and pains, adults can easily access moderate analgesics at any regional apotek. However, Sweden carries out particular steps to promote safe use:
Age Limits: Pharmacies are lawfully bound to confirm that purchasers of particular OTC medications (such as paracetamol) fulfill the minimum age requirement, normally 18 years of ages.
Quantity Restrictions: To prevent unintentional or deliberate overdosing, pharmacies limit the variety of packages a customer can acquire in a single deal.
Pharmacist Consultation: Swedish pharmacists (farmaceuter) are highly trained healthcare professionals. If a consumer approaches the counter requesting for strong pain relief, the pharmacist will typically ask targeted concerns to make sure the medication is suitable and to advise speaking with a physician if symptoms continue.
Obtaining Prescription Pain Medication
If OTC medications are insufficient-- such as in cases of extreme injury, post-operative healing, or chronic pain conditions-- a prescription is mandatory.
How to See a Doctor in Sweden
1177 Vårdguiden: This is the primary health care advisory service in Sweden. By calling 1177 or visiting their website, individuals can get totally free medical suggestions in numerous languages and assistance on where to look for care.
Vårdcentral (Health Center): For non-emergency pain, patients reserve a visit at their local neighborhood health center.
Akuten (Emergency Room): For abrupt, severe injury or acute, unbearable pain, individuals need to check out the health center emergency department or call the emergency number 112.
Digital Healthcare Providers (Kry, Min Doktor, and so on)
Sweden has a robust digital health infrastructure. Apps and digital platforms enable clients to talk to licensed physicians through video call. While these doctors can detect conditions and prescribe lots of kinds of medication digitally (sent directly to a main database available by all drug stores), rigorous controls apply to narcotics and strong opioids, which rarely-to-never are prescribed exclusively through a quick digital assessment without an in-person physical examination and recognized client history.
Importing Pain Medication Into Sweden
For travelers visiting Sweden who require routine pain management, specific guidelines govern the importation of pharmaceuticals:
From within the EEA/Schengen Area: Travelers carrying individual medications can usually raise to a 3-year supply for individual use, offered they can prove the medication is for genuine medical treatment (e.g., a prescription, drug store receipt, or a Schengen certificate for narcotics).
From outside the EEA: Travelers are normally limited to a 3-month supply of personal medication. Strong painkillers classified as narcotics go through strenuous customs checks; carrying them without proper documents (such as a physician's letter in English) can result in confiscation and legal complications.

1. Can I purchase strong painkillers like codeine or tramadol over the counter in Sweden?
No. All opioid-based medications, consisting of codeine combinations, tramadol, and more powerful narcotics, need a legitimate prescription provided by a certified physician authorized to practice within the Swedish healthcare system.
2. Can I use a foreign prescription at a Swedish drug store?
Prescriptions released in other EU/EEA nations can usually be filled at Swedish pharmacies, supplied the prescription consists of all needed patient and doctor details. Prescriptions from outside the EU/EEA are typically not accepted, and the client needs to consult a regional Swedish medical professional to obtain a legitimate prescription.
3. Are online drug stores safe to utilize in Sweden?
Yes, however only if they are legally licensed. The Swedish Medical Products Agency keeps a public pc registry of approved online pharmacies. These websites display a common EU logo design showing safe operation. Ordering prescription or strong pain medication from unregulated, unproven online websites running outside the legal structure is prohibited and postures serious health dangers due to fake products.
